Output 5e7085d42d46a57fdca91b0afacf4b705fa6291daeae7b1a2bca56f9209ec7d4:39

value
2845636
script pubkey
OP_0 OP_PUSHBYTES_20 1f3dfad6429dedbc89f6f00ddeadf7e499015cf4
address
bc1qru7l44jznhkmez0k7qxaat0hujvszh853gu5r7
transaction
5e7085d42d46a57fdca91b0afacf4b705fa6291daeae7b1a2bca56f9209ec7d4
confirmations
143421
spent
true